Removed usage of the deprecated critical section constructor in media_file.
Review URL: http://webrtc-codereview.appspot.com/321004 git-svn-id: http://webrtc.googlecode.com/svn/trunk@1187 4adac7df-926f-26a2-2b94-8c16560cd09d
This commit is contained in:
parent
780a07a843
commit
7cdcde3460
@ -39,8 +39,8 @@ void MediaFile::DestroyMediaFile(MediaFile* module)
|
|||||||
|
|
||||||
MediaFileImpl::MediaFileImpl(const WebRtc_Word32 id)
|
MediaFileImpl::MediaFileImpl(const WebRtc_Word32 id)
|
||||||
: _id(id),
|
: _id(id),
|
||||||
_crit(*CriticalSectionWrapper::CreateCriticalSection()),
|
_crit(CriticalSectionWrapper::CreateCriticalSection()),
|
||||||
_callbackCrit(*CriticalSectionWrapper::CreateCriticalSection()),
|
_callbackCrit(CriticalSectionWrapper::CreateCriticalSection()),
|
||||||
_ptrFileUtilityObj(NULL),
|
_ptrFileUtilityObj(NULL),
|
||||||
codec_info_(),
|
codec_info_(),
|
||||||
_ptrInStream(NULL),
|
_ptrInStream(NULL),
|
||||||
@ -90,8 +90,8 @@ MediaFileImpl::~MediaFileImpl()
|
|||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
delete &_crit;
|
delete _crit;
|
||||||
delete &_callbackCrit;
|
delete _callbackCrit;
|
||||||
}
|
}
|
||||||
|
|
||||||
WebRtc_Word32 MediaFileImpl::Version(WebRtc_Word8* version,
|
WebRtc_Word32 MediaFileImpl::Version(WebRtc_Word8* version,
|
||||||
|
@ -223,8 +223,8 @@ private:
|
|||||||
void HandlePlayCallbacks(WebRtc_Word32 bytesRead);
|
void HandlePlayCallbacks(WebRtc_Word32 bytesRead);
|
||||||
|
|
||||||
WebRtc_Word32 _id;
|
WebRtc_Word32 _id;
|
||||||
CriticalSectionWrapper& _crit;
|
CriticalSectionWrapper* _crit;
|
||||||
CriticalSectionWrapper& _callbackCrit;
|
CriticalSectionWrapper* _callbackCrit;
|
||||||
|
|
||||||
ModuleFileUtility* _ptrFileUtilityObj;
|
ModuleFileUtility* _ptrFileUtilityObj;
|
||||||
CodecInst codec_info_;
|
CodecInst codec_info_;
|
||||||
|
Loading…
Reference in New Issue
Block a user